If the basement smells damp even when it looks dry, moisture is likely moving through the walls or floor somewhere.
Even small cracks are worth a second look — they rarely stay small once seasonal ground movement gets involved.
That white chalky film on basement walls is efflorescence — mineral deposits left behind as water evaporates through concrete.
If your pump is running around the clock instead of only during storms, it's worth having it evaluated before it fails completely.
A bowing basement wall is a structural concern in addition to a water one — this is the kind of Allons call we prioritize fast.
Peeling paint low on a basement wall or warped baseboards upstairs often trace back to moisture migrating up from below.
